Special Conditions: Aerospace Quality Research and Development, Textron Aviation Inc. Model 680A Latitude Airplane; Rechargeable Lithium Batteries and Battery Systems Installations

These special conditions are issued for the Textron Aviation Inc. (Textron) Model 680A Latitude airplane, as modified by Aerospace Quality Research and Development (AQRD). These airplanes will have a novel or unusual design feature when compared to the state of technology envisioned in the airworthiness standards for transport- category airplanes. This design feature is the installation of two rechargeable lithium batteries and battery system that will replace two nickel-cadmium batteries previously installed on the airplane. The applicable airworthiness regulations do not contain adequate or appropriate safety standards for this design feature. These special conditions contain the additional safety standards that the Administrator considers necessary to establish a level of safety equivalent to that established by the existing airworthiness standards.

Rescission of the Notice of Intent to Prepare an Environmental Impact Statement for the Route 2/2A/32 Corridor Improvements Project, New London County, Connecticut

The FHWA, in cooperation with the Connecticut Department of Transportation (CTDOT) is issuing this Notice to advise the public that we are rescinding the June 3, 1996, Notice of Intent (NOI) to prepare an Environmental Impact Statement (EIS) for the Route 2/2A/32 Project in New London County, Connecticut. We are rescinding the NOI because a substantial amount of time has passed since its publication and there is a need to re-evaluate traffic growth and congestion in the region.
